TABLE "B" SAMPLES ADULTERATED, Etc.

Serial No.Article.Whether Formal, Informal or Private.Nature of Adulteration or Irregularity.Observations.Result of Proceedings or other Action taken.
8MilkFormalArticle contained 1 per cent, of added water.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
41DoDo.48 per cent, of the original fat abstracted.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 10s. 6d. costs.
52Do.Do.Article contained 1 per cent, of added water.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
69DoDo.Article contained 0.8 per cent, of added water.Do. Do.
99Do.Do.4 per cent, of the original fat abstracted.Do. Do.
139Do.Do.11 per cent. of the original fat abstracted.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 10s. 6d. costs.
149Do.Do.Article contained 1.3 per cent. of added water.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
204Do.Do.Article contained 2.0 per cent, of added water.Do.
343Do.Do.Article contained 3.3 per cent, of added water.Do.
530Do.Do.12 per cent, of the original fat abstracted.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 10s. 6d. costs.
717Do.Do.Article contained 1.1 per cent, of added water.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
972Do.Do.Article contained 1.0 per cent, of added water.Do. Do.
134VinegarDo.Deficient in Acetic Acid to the extent of 11 per cent.Do. Do.
185Malt VinegarDo.A sample of Vinegar, other than Malt Vinegar.Do. Do.
191Do.Do.Do. Do.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 10s. 6d. costs.
197Do.Do.Sample deficient in Acetic Acid to the extent of 8 per cent.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
531Do.Do.Sample deficient in Acetic Acid to the extent of 31 per cent.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 10s. 6d. costs.
163Raspberry JamDo.Article contained excess of 39 parts per million of Sulphur Dioxide.Proceedings taken against the wholesale firm.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 21s. costs.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 21s. costs.
202Do.Do.Article contained excess of 45 parts per million of Sulphur Dioxide.

TABLE "B" SAMPLES ADULTERATED, Etc.—continued.

Serial No.Article.Whether Formal, Informal or Private.Nature of Adulteration or Irregularity.Observations.Result of Proceedings or other Action taken.
398Raspberry JamFormalDeficient in fruit to the extent of 28 per cent. of the amount that should have been present.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
983Do.Do.Article deficient in Raspberries to the extent of 15 per cent.Do. Do.
248Beef SausagesDo.Article contained Sulphur Dioxide to the extent of 98 parts per million.Sold without notice of the presence of a preservative.Do. Do.
290Do.Do.Article contained Sulphur Dioxide to the extent of 338 parts per million.Summons dismissed under the Probation of Offenders Act. Defendant to pay 10s. 6d. costs.
358Do.Do.Article contained Sulphur Dioxide to the extent of 91 parts per million.Do.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
782Do.Do.Article contained Sulphur Dioxide to the extent of 110 parts per million.Do.Do. Do.
354ArrowrootDo.Article contained 3.75 per cent, of Boric Acid.Defendant ordered to pay 25s. fine and 21s. costs.
928PrescriptionDo.Article contained excess of Hydrochloric Acid to the extent of 30 per cent, of the amount prescribed.Caution. Resolution of the Public Health Committee.
24Tinned FishInformalArticle contained 3.41 grains per lb. of tin.
25Do.Do.Article contained 3.25 grains per lb. of tin.
27Do.Do.Article contained 5.17 grains per lb. of tin.
31Do.Do.Article contained 3.58 grains per lb. of tin.
32Do.Do.Article contained 2.69 grains per lb. of tin.
33Do.Do.Article contained 2.96 grains per lb. of tin.
34Do.Do.Article contained 3.57 grains per lb. of tin.
35Do.Do.Article contained 2.63 grains per lb. of tin.
